Hôtel Restaurant Panoramique César - Logis Hôtel
Perched on a plateau within the scenic Parc Naturel du Luberon, this quaint 2-star tourist hotel offers casual, air-conditioned rooms with complimentary Wi-Fi. The property boasts a low-key restaurant where guests can enjoy carefully prepared Provençal cuisine while taking in expansive valley views, including Mont Ventoux. The atmosphere balances simplicity with thoughtful touches, making it a comfortable stop for travelers exploring the region.
Located just 12 km from the medieval Château de Lourmarin and 17 km from the Musée de la Lavande, the hotel is ideally positioned for discovering nearby cultural landmarks. The surroundings are rich with natural and historical attractions, including the iconic Abbaye Notre-Dame de Sénanque and the vivid cliffs of Le Sentier des Ocres, both offering immersive outdoor experiences. Guests appreciate the welcoming ambiance as well as the owner-chef’s passion, which is evident in the well-crafted meals served here.
